Artist Statement

My art delves into the pervasive influence of the digital age, weaving together threads of spirituality, environmental consciousness, and technological expansion. Through densely layered digital collages, I construct dreamlike realms where familiar visual cues of time and space are reimagined. Symbols like water and seascapes evoke themes of the unconscious mind, while abandoned spaces reflect our negative impact on the environment. The integration of mechanical elements with organic forms hints at the evolving relationship between technology and humanity.

​

My process begins with sketching concepts on paper, which I then develop in Photoshop to create digital collages. These collages are further translated into mixed media, laser engravings, and assemblages. The assemblage works, made with found objects, may also incorporate digital artworks in print form. Some works, incorporating found objects, explore the themes of climate change, transhumanism, and the spiritual realm and are sometimes infused with personal narratives of sleep deprivation and its distortion of reality. I create mixed media pieces on custom wood panels that I fabricate myself. On these panels, I trace the design and employ acrylic paints, wood stains, colored pencils, pastels, and collage.

​

The subject matter dictates the palette and imagery, ensuring each piece is a unique exploration of these interconnected themes. Driven by ongoing research, my work continually evolves, each series building upon previous inquiries and fostering new areas of investigation.

Bio

Vincent Mattina is an established multidisciplinary artist whose work explores the intricate connections between spirituality, environmentalism, and the evolving landscape of technology. A graduate of Columbus College of Art and Design, he utilizes digital collage, mixed media, and assemblage techniques to create surreal and immersive experiences. His art is characterized by a dreamlike and mysterious quality, transporting viewers to alternate realms where science, nature, and the spiritual intersect. 

​

Mattina's distinctive style, often characterized by a mystifying quality, often focuses on the critical theme of climate change, prompting viewers to consider its potential consequences. Another highlight of his work is the ongoing series “Sleepless”, where he shows us a personal reflection on his sleep disorders and brings them to life. This series creates a strong connection between consciousness and floating, dreaming and drowning, even sleep and death. Through this, Vincent Mattina’s sleep-deprived suffering becomes a shared meditation.

​

Mattina's work has been exhibited extensively, including at the San Diego Art Institute, Brand Library and Art Center, Southampton Art Center, and in Utah at the Springville Museum of Art, Bountiful Davis Art Center, Finch Lane Gallery, and Urban Arts Gallery. His work has been featured online at 15 Bytes, KUER.org, and Times of San Diego.
